Material Preparation
We select mature yak bone and horn, carefully dried and stabilized to prevent cracking. The material is cleaned, cut, and shaped while preserving its natural grain and structure.
-
Carving and Shaping
Each bead is carved and balanced by hand. No industrial polishing is used. Natural pores, fiber lines, and tonal differences remain visible as part of the material’s character.
-
Finishing and Aging
Beads may undergo traditional oil or smoke treatment to protect the surface and deepen tone. With wear, the material gradually develops a smoother texture and natural patina.
